Who is Rahu and What Does He Represent in a Birth Chart?

Rahu is the north node of the Moon, a shadow planet without physical mass but immense psychological influence. In Vedic astrology, Rahu represents desire, illusion, ambition, rebellion, and disruption. It magnifies what it touches, often pushing the native to want what they haven’t yet mastered.

Rahu works through hunger, the kind that doesn't easily go away. It brings foreign experiences, unconventional paths, and karmic lessons disguised as cravings. Where Rahu sits, the soul wants something and sometimes too much, sometimes too fast.

What Happens When Rahu Sits in the 11th House?

Rahu in the 11th house intensifies your drive to achieve, network, and be recognized. This is one of Rahu’s most materially ambitious placements. The native often has bold dreams, not just to succeed, but to stand out while doing it.

There’s a hunger for popularity, social reach, and financial gain. The person may work hard to build connections, influence, and visibility and sometimes using unconventional or risky methods. They may feel at ease in groups, but also struggle with shallow or transactional friendships.

Because Rahu deals with illusion, success here can feel hollow if it’s disconnected from purpose. The native may achieve fame, wealth, or influence, only to realize they’re still unsatisfied. That’s Rahu’s paradox: it gives you what you think you want, so you can realize what you actually need.

Friendly and Enemy Planet Influences

Friendly planets like Venus, Mercury, and Saturn bring stability to Rahu’s ambition.

  • Venus supports charm and likability in social networks.

  • Mercury brings clever communication, helpful for networking or influencing.

  • Saturn adds discipline, helping Rahu pursue long-term goals with structure.

Enemy planets like the Sun and Moon challenge this placement.

  • The Sun may lead to power struggles, ego traps, or burnout from chasing authority.

  • The Moon makes emotional connection with friends harder, often creating a sense of isolation or emotional discontent despite external success.

Neutral planets such as Jupiter and Mars can go either way.

  • Mars boosts competitive drive, but may cause social aggression or burnout.

  • Jupiter helps Rahu align with causes or communities, but only if values stay intact.
